Simultaneous Determination of Sodium, Potassium, Manganese and Bromine in Tea by Standard Addition Neutron Activation Analysis |

Abstract: | Standard addition method was applied for neutron activation analysis of tea leaves. Four brands of tea leaves were analyzed
for its Na, K, Mn, and Br contents by this method. The Na, K, Mn, and Br concentrations were found to be in the 90–120 μg/g,
1.8–2.1% w/w, 150–500 and 3–7 μg/g ranges, respectively. The extraction efficiency of these elements, during the infusion, was calculated
by analysis of tea leaves before and after the infusion process. It was observed that about 90% of the Na, K, and Br elements
were extracted to water during the infusion process. The drinking tea is a rich source of Mn (despite of an extraction efficiency
of 50% for this element). |
